Fluffy Logic – my favourite club night – good vibes and good House music
With just a few days to go to the next Fluffy Logic, it’s about time I blogged about this awesome club night – my favourite right now! As you can gather from the name, it’s a very fluffy party. What’s fluffy? That could fill an entire post on it’s own. For now, think friendly crowd, positive music, fancy dress, facepaint, and so on…
I love Fluffy Logic as an event name. I see it as a play on the saying ‘fuzzy logic’, like when you put 2 and 2 together and get 5. There’s certainly no requirement for straight thinking at this party. As their flyer says: “talk nonsense, dance til dawn, it’ll be lovely”. And lovely it is.
I also dig the inclusion of the word ‘logic’, along with the LCD style lettering that has appeared on 2 of their flyers so far. To me, logic is quite an important part of dance music… It’s logic that drives most of the technology that goes into bringing dance music to us, whether it’s the synth that makes the sounds, the computer that records them, or the CD player the DJ uses on the night.
The music at both parties so far has been a good mix of different styles of House music – minimal, deep, tech, disco and even a bit of swing. Resident DJ Toby Lyons has done a pretty good job so far of lining up the DJs and programming our musical journey.
Aside from the music, another awesome element of the party is the decor – one piece of which is the amazing fibre-optic tree. A still photo wouldn’t do it justice, so I had to make a video of it. This tree is just the beginnings of a whole ‘fibre-optic forest’. I was helping decor artist Hannah Geller with some flower painting last weekend
In addition to the intimate main dancefloor there are 3 chillout areas, including the Diddlee Tea Room (serving ‘after-moon’ tea and all-night breakfast).
Last time I got to meet DJ and producer Asad Rizvi. Asad has been quite a hit at Fluffy Logic – his tunes went down a treat at the first party, and he has been booked for every one since then! I’m looking forward to hearing him playing again this Friday, and will most likely be Shazamming every other track he plays
